April 19, 2013- ALBANY, GA- Four Albany Technical College students brought home awards during the SkillsUSA State Competition held in Atlanta March 21-23, 2013.


All students received medals in the following program areas: Sharonda Bussey (Third Place, Dental Assisting); Ernest Brown (First Place, Masonry); Kristina Mathis (Second Place, Medical Math); and De'Keria King (Second Place, Cosmetology).


Ernest Brown, who won First Place in Masonry, has qualified to compete in the National Championship in Kansas City, MO, where he will compete against other students from different states.


SkillsUSA is a partnership of students, teachers, and industry working together to ensure America has a skilled workforce. SkillsUSA's mission is to empower its members to become world-class workers, leaders, and responsible American cititzens.
